Output dea91ba229d21a5630a475200dd0ce0ccb67ae5f1dddc847f1e2a606172127d2:0

value
11672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beb51513f80cab64b0193f96e163dcd80258d1e5 OP_EQUAL
address
3K5PEp6YZvbiX6qPdWSuH9BAidW4GRPEzE
transaction
dea91ba229d21a5630a475200dd0ce0ccb67ae5f1dddc847f1e2a606172127d2
spent
true